To work as part of a busy team to cover various areas to include daily bank reconciliations, month end process, daily banking receipts/cancellations. Assist with daily day to day finance duties.
Key Accountabilities
To manage and maintain our client accounts, ensure policies and procedures are in place at all times.
Working Hours 35 hours per week
Monday – Friday 9am – 5pm with 1 unpaid hour for lunch. Primary location for this role is Liverpool St Paul’s Square
Experience, Skills and Qualifications
•Experience of working in a busy Finance team. •Ability to use Excel. •To be able to maintain accuracy and attention to detail whilst dealing with high volumes. •A positive attitude and strong work ethic that is keen to learn and explore new ideas. •Well organised with the ability to prioritise. •Ability to communicate effectively to team members, colleagues and clients.
